It was composed in 1816 and premiered in Leipzig in 1819, with Hummel himself as the soloist. The first movement, marked Allegro moderato, begins with a dramatic orchestral introduction before the piano enters with a virtuosic solo passage. The movement features a lyrical second theme and a development section that showcases the pianist's technical abilities. The second movement, marked Larghetto, is a beautiful and expressive slow movement. The piano introduces a simple, singing melody that is then taken up by the orchestra. The movement features several variations on this theme, with the piano and orchestra trading off in a dialogue-like fashion. The final movement, marked Allegro agitato, is a lively and energetic rondo. The piano and orchestra engage in a playful back-and-forth, with the piano introducing a catchy main theme that is then developed and varied throughout the movement. The concerto ends with a thrilling coda that showcases the pianist's virtuosity. Hummel's Piano Concerto in A minor is characterized by its technical demands on the soloist, as well as its beautiful melodies and expressive lyricism. The work is a testament to Hummel's skill as both a composer and a pianist, and remains a beloved piece in the piano concerto repertoire.More....
